/* For an application, returns the main bundle of the application.
For a tool, returns the main bundle associated with the tool (this
is experimental and not yet supported by gnustep-make, but will
soon be).
For an application, the structure is as follows -
The executable is Gomoku.app/ix86/linux-gnu/gnu-gnu-gnu/Gomoku
and the main bundle directory is Gomoku.app/.
For a tool, the structure is as follows -
The executable is xxx/Tools/ix86/linux-gnu/gnu-gnu-gnu/Control
and the main bundle directory is xxx/Tools/Resources/Control.
(when the tool has not yet been installed, it's similar -
xxx/shared_obj/ix86/linux-gnu/gnu-gnu-gnu/Control
and the main bundle directory is xxx/Resources/Control).
(For a flattened structure, the structure is the same without the
ix86/linux-gnu/gnu-gnu-gnu directories). */
